Fan Expectation Is High For The Orioles

SARASOTA, Fla. (WJZ) -- Before you know it, there will be plenty of traffic around Orioles Park at Camden Yards. Expectations will be high for the Birds, the defending American League East champs.

After 14 straight losing seasons, the Orioles are on a winning streak. With better players, better management and a new attitude, they now expect to win---and those who have played for a the team a while now know how low those expectations once were.

"I think I was kind of tired of people telling me `Oh, you play for the Orioles? You guys aren't very good,'" said Zach Britton.

Britton's been in the Orioles organization continuously longer than anyone else on the team and he's seen the culture change.

"We know we're a good team. We don't need anyone else to tell us that we're not. We know that we are, " he said.

"You see how the hard work pays off in the end," said Matt Wieters. "Now, you know what's expected and everyone holds each other accountable in that locker room."

Three straight winning seasons including a Division title, but baseball experts predict the O's streak of success will end this season and the O's embrace the role of underdog.

With a chip on their shoulder and a division championship on their resume, the O's, once again, will seek to prove the prognosticators wrong.
